logo

Output 13018fab28cfa6af961430b619bd5e89138a067d19e0df17c682b69ae4793c9e:1

value
16420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69a074433eaa564dbeda4478f814506a6abfc697 OP_EQUALVERIFY OP_CHECKSIG
address
1AdWAh95oNVnizEQanX1J8Eqjc1H87HfVR
transaction
13018fab28cfa6af961430b619bd5e89138a067d19e0df17c682b69ae4793c9e